Output 8e88c08343c8947ad874614f0b24e0707f3d97c7203de6558d93404867f16fda:1917

value
521178
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ca6494f52eddd1b810510488bb465a5fdef7672 OP_EQUALVERIFY OP_CHECKSIG
address
17zHZMniVv2rVVXoU9ayi7YZyRhdNCw6du
transaction
8e88c08343c8947ad874614f0b24e0707f3d97c7203de6558d93404867f16fda
confirmations
304984
spent
true